I'm a lonely island
drowning on dry land
know only how to conceal
can you show me how to feel?
I'm the force of a hurricane
the saddest drizzle of rain
radiant light from above
a lousy puddle of mud
I'm caught in the current
this can't be unlearnt
It’s how I'll always be
a strong raging sea
or a tremoring leaf,
a neglected coral reef
darling
there's a big storm coming
and I'm already running
I'll disappear into the dusk
now that I've felt your touch
I think I'm scared of love
what am I void of?
unable to trust
covered in rust
leave if you must
a sun hidden in shadow
the last phase of the moon
a long forgotten meadow
facing an end too soon
